A docente do Departamento de Matemática (DMA) e investigadora no Laboratório de Engenharia Matemática (LEMA), Carla Pinto, participa no Encontro no Douro: Equações Diferenciais e Aplicações, que se realiza entre 2-4 de Outubro, em Armamar.

A presença de Carla Pinto nesta conferência serve para apresentar a comunicação “ODEs and CPG Models for Locomotion”

We review CPG models for locomotion. CPGs are commonly modelled by coupled cell systems, where each cell models one neuron, or more plausible, collections of neurons.
CPG-like coupled cell systems are able to produce sustained rhythmic activation patterns even when isolated from external stimuli. CPGs have other nice properties, such as limit cycle behaviour, phase-locking modes, robustness against small perturbations and smooth online modulation of trajectories. All these characteristics can be achieved through changes in parameter values of the equations. These features make CPGs an attractive option to model the control of legged robot locomotion for bipedal, quadruped and other designs
